We would all like to be wiser. There are ways to gain wisdom. Education gives knowledge, and practice of things learned brings about wisdom. Life situations are better walked through when wisdom has been gained through experience. The study of psychology explains emotional tools we can use to make us stronger in mind and behavior as we face the uncertainties and hard knocks of relationships with ourselves and with others.
All of the above helps us to attain knowledge that may lead to wisdom, but does it give us lasting joy, peace, meaning in life, and hope that never fades? What is the difference between wisdom learned on earth and wisdom given by God? Let’s take a look at Proverbs 3:13-18: “Joyful is the person who finds wisdom, the one who gains understanding. For wisdom is more profitable that silver, and her wages are better than gold. Wisdom is more precious than rubies; nothing you desire can compare with her. She offers you a long life in her right hand, and riches and honor in her left. She will guide you down delightful paths; all her ways are satisfying. Wisdom is a tree of life to those who embrace her; happy are those who hold her tightly.”
Wisdom we gain on earth is profitable. It will help us in difficult situations. It will help us to be stronger in broken relationships and in dealing with circumstances that frighten us. Learning and practicing wisdom through education and practice is not a bad thing, but it will never take us to the heights of hope and joy that the wisdom from God can take us. You see, the wisdom of the world is incomplete. The wisdom of the world cannot help us to understand the riches of life in the spiritual realm.
In the spiritual realm we learn to take hold of a joy that surpasses any other happiness found on earth. In the spiritual realm we come to understand the value that God Himself places on each one of us; we know that we are precious to Him and loved beyond measure. This love surpasses any earthly love. (If one has not experienced the personal love of God, the above will make no sense, because spiritual wisdom can only be gained by those who know Jesus Christ personally.) Spiritual wisdom gives us insight to life after death; the light that those in Christ will live in for eternity, and the darkness that those who reject Christ will live in, also for eternity. Do you see the explanation of the above scripture in Proverbs 3:18 ; “…wisdom is a tree of life…”
There are many ways to gain wisdom to help us educationally and relationally on this earth, but there is only one way to gain the wisdom of God that will let us soar the heights of splendor, dive deep into pure love, and embrace hope for an amazing, eternal future.
Such wisdom is available to anyone who reaches out to take this gift from God; given through receiving His Son Jesus, believing He died and rose again, conquering death, forgiving all sin, granting eternal life with Him. This wisdom is literally from out of this world.
